Fill Them with Excitement

Remember that the invitations for a wedding provide the starting mood for the ceremony, and if people receive boring invitations, perhaps they think the marriage will be boring. On the other hand, if they receive one that makes their eyes pop they will probably feel excited and flattered they were invited.

So don’t hesitate on giving your invitations a personal touch, and be the person who makes other couples want to copy your invitation.
